Warning Signs You Need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Our team is here to help you identify the warning signs and provide a solution.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your laundry room or other areas of your home can show hidden moisture.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leaky washing machine or other water source. Don’t wait to address this issue, as it can cause further damage and lead to cost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show excess moisture or water damage.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to further damage and need cost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ks from your washing machine or other water source can show a problem.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to further damage and need costly repairs.
Visible Water Damage or Puddles
Visible water damage or puddles in your laundry room or other areas of your home can show a leaky washing machine or other water source. Don’t wait to address this issue, as it can cause further damage and lead to costly repairs.
Unpleasant Odors or Slime
Unpleasant odors or slime in your laundry room or other areas of your home can show hidden moisture or mold growth.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to further damage and need costly repairs.

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al Cost in Hunts Point, WA
The cost of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hunts Point, WA.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ing the situation. Here are some estimated costs for common services related to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water extracted, equipment used,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Report |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the job |
